Mac and Cheese
Creamy and comforting Mac and Cheese, topped with golden gratinated cheese.
30 min2 servingsEasyInternational
780kcal / serving
28.5 gprotein
65.2 gcarbs
41.8 gfat
Ingredients
- 300 grams Elbow macaroni
- 60 grams Unsalted butter
- 60 grams All-purpose flour
- 750 ml Whole milk
- 250 grams Cheddar cheese (medium or sharp)
- 100 grams Gruyere cheese
- 1 teaspoon Salt
- ½ teaspoon Freshly ground black pepper
- ¼ teaspoon Grated nutmeg
Directions
- Cook macaroni in boiling salted water until al dente. Drain and set aside.
- In a medium sa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Stir in flour and cook for 1-2 minutes, stirring to form a roux.
- Gradually add milk, whisking to combine. Bring to a gentle boil and cook, stirring, until thickened.
- Remove from heat. Stir in grated cheeses until completely melted. Season with salt, pepper, and nutmeg.
- Combine cooked macaroni with cheese sauce. Serve hot.
